Lower Peninsula
The Lower Peninsula of Michigan is a treasure trove of natural wonders, from the rolling dunes along Lake Michigan to the serene forests and lakes of the northern Lower Peninsula. This region boasts a vast selection of private campgrounds, catering to diverse preferences.
Lake Michigan Shores
The western shore of Lake Michigan is renowned for its expansive beaches, stunning sunsets, and vibrant coastal towns. Campgrounds in this region offer easy access to the beach, perfect for swimming, sunbathing, and enjoying the refreshing breeze of the lake. Consider campgrounds near Grand Haven, Muskegon, or Holland for an unforgettable Lake Michigan experience.
Northern Lower Peninsula
The northern Lower Peninsula is a haven for outdoor enthusiasts, with its dense forests, sparkling lakes, and abundant wildlife. Campgrounds in this region offer a tranquil and secluded atmosphere, perfect for escaping the crowds and immersing yourself in nature’s embrace. Explore campgrounds near Traverse City, Petoskey, or Mackinaw City for a taste of the true beauty of the northern Lower Peninsula.
Upper Peninsula
The Upper Peninsula of Michigan is a remote and rugged region, known for its vast forests, pristine lakes, and stunning waterfalls. Campgrounds in this region offer a truly adventurous experience, perfect for hikers, kayakers, and nature lovers seeking an escape from the ordinary.
Keweenaw Peninsula
The Keweenaw Peninsula is a remote and scenic region, known for its towering copper mines, dramatic coastline, and abundant wildlife. Campgrounds in this region offer a secluded and rustic experience, perfect for those who appreciate the raw beauty of the Upper Peninsula. Explore campgrounds near Houghton, Hancock, or Copper Harbor for a taste of the Keweenaw’s natural wonders.
Sault Ste. Marie
Sault Ste. Marie is a charming city located on the St. Marys River, the gateway to Lake Superior. Campgrounds in this region offer easy access to the river, perfect for boating, fishing, and exploring the historic sites of the city. Discover campgrounds near Sault Ste. Marie for an unforgettable Upper Peninsula experience.

Reservations and Availability
Many private campgrounds in Michigan require reservations, especially during peak season. To avoid disappointment, book your campsite well in advance, especially if you’re planning a trip during popular holidays or weekends. Check the campground’s website or call to inquire about availability and reservation policies.
Campground Fees and Payment Options
Private campgrounds charge varying fees based on the type of campsite, amenities included, and length of stay. Be sure to inquire about the campground’s fee structure and payment options before making a reservation. Some campgrounds may offer discounts for seniors, military personnel, or families.

What are the benefits of staying at a private campground?
Private campgrounds often offer advantages compared to public campgrounds, including:
– **Greater privacy and seclusion:** Private campgrounds often have more spacious campsites and fewer campers, providing a more peaceful and intimate experience.
– **Unique amenities and activities:** Private campgrounds may offer amenities such as swimming pools, playgrounds, game rooms, on-site restaurants, and a variety of recreational activities.
– **More personalized service:** Private campground staff often provide more personalized attention and assistance, making your stay more comfortable and enjoyable.
How do I find a private campground in Michigan?
Finding a private campground in Michigan is made easier with online resources such as:
– **Campendium:** Campendium is a popular website and app that offers extensive information on private campgrounds across the United States, including reviews, photos, and amenities.
– **The Dyrt:** The Dyrt is another popular website and app that provides user reviews, photos, and information on campgrounds, including private and public options.
– **RV Park Reviews:** This website specializes in reviews of RV parks and campgrounds, providing insights from fellow RVers.
– **Google Maps:** Use Google Maps to search for “private campgrounds” in your desired region of Michigan.
– **State travel websites:** Visit the Michigan Department of Natural Resources (DNR) or other state travel websites for lists of private campgrounds and their contact information.
